Student Veteran Responsibilities
APPROVED COURSES: You must register for courses that are required for your academic and degree program. The Veterans
Administration (VA) only pays benefits for those courses that are part of an approved degree program, and that have not been
previously and successfully completed. Please refer to your program evaluation and/or contact the Chapman University Advising
Center or your major advisor to be sure the classes you are taking will apply towards your major and degree.
SCHEDULE ADJUSTMENTS: You have until the add/drop deadline to make adjustments to your academic schedule. Changes in
enrollment after the last day to drop and add courses may result in the retroactive loss of benefits unless the VA finds mitigating
circumstances involved in the change. Loss of benefits could revert back to the first day of class.
CHANGE IN MAJOR: If, at a later date, you wish to change your academic program, you must complete a Change of Major form.
Be sure to alert the Chapman University VA Certifying Officer (va@chapman.edu)
WITHDRAWAL FROM A COURSE: You must report a withdrawal (“W”) from a course to the VA Certifying Officer immediately.
VA payment is based on academic progress so you must be enrolled and successfully completing your courses to be eligible for VA
benefits. All withdrawals will be retroactively reported to the VA and may result in the retroactive loss of benefits unless the VA
finds mitigating circumstances involved in the change. Loss of benefits could revert back to the first day of class.
CHANGE IN ENROLLMENT: Federal law requires you to report any change in your enrollment status that might affect your VA
education benefits. It is your responsibility to notify the VA Certifying Officer located in the University Registrar’s Office of any
changes in your status. This includes alterations to class schedule, change of major and change of address. Changes should be
reported promptly to avoid delay in payments or possible overpayments.
REFUNDS: Refunds will be processed in accordance with published Chapman University’s policy and will be refunded directly to
the issuer of payment.
Acknowledgement of Responsibilities
☑ I am aware I will be financially responsible for payment of fees not covered by the VA.
☑ I am responsible for all VA debts resulting from reductions or termination of enrollment, even if the payment was
directly submitted on my behalf.
☑ I am aware that changes in my registration may alter the payment the VA will award me.
☑ I am aware that any applicable refunds will be processed in accordance with published Chapman University policy,
and will be submitted directly to the issuer of payment.
